What is zmd?
Zmd hosts a variety of utilities and services that you can access via curl in a CLI. These include a URL shortener, a weather checker, a PH day-rank checker, and 10 more tools. Visit zmd.ee or curl zmd.ee/help for usage tips.

Solution
Zmd is a terminal-based tool that integrates a variety of utilities directly accessible via curl commands in a CLI environment.
